ESTIMATION OF WATER-ENERGY-FOOD (WEF) SERVICING VALUES BASED ON A CASE STUDY ON GUIZHOU PROVINCE

This paper uses concept and method of ecosystem servicing values to establish an estimating system of water-energy-food servicing values, which is used to estimate its servicing values of Guizhou's water-energy-food on economy and ecology and their ties. The gross servicing values is stable with declining. The servicing value of water resource lies in moderation of natural ecology and plays a critical role on the gross servicing values. Energy has a larger positive servicing value on social economy, but at a much larger negative ecological cost, which is the root cause of falling servicing value of WEF. The servicing values of food is increasing, providing a support to supply of social economy. The servicing value of WEF tie in Guizhou is small and unstable, so it suggests Guizhou fulfill water resources advantages in order to stabilize its servicing values. Boosting the servicing value of energy to social economy needs to prevent its impact on natural ecology, and to prevent panel pollution on food production, and to develop tourism and ecological agriculture. Moreover, moderation of WEF tie to improve the stability of system.
